78 Cruising Wagon at Mecum Chattanooga
« on: September 02, 2021, 08:21:04 AM »
78 Cruising Wagon at Mecum Chattanooga

Will be at Mecum Chattanooga on Friday, Oct 15th! Phone and internet bid options are available! Link follows with listing, pics, details:
https://www.mecum.com/lots/CT1021-483296/1978-ford-pinto-cruising-wagon/
This has been a fun, reliable car for me for almost seven years, but it needs a new home. Mostly original paint (left side was painted after a dent was pulled), original interior and engine bay. I'm the third owner of this CA car with 78,XXX miles. NO RUST! Looks to have been garaged all its life, with bright, shiny paint. A few typical dings on the outside and just one dash crack and a couple of small cracks in the driver's seat. A little sun fading on seat shoulders and carpet, but still a great looking interior! Runs and drives great!
